Description: Homo sapiens interleukin 18 (interferon-gamma-inducing factor) (IL18), transcript variant 2, mRNA. RefSeq Summary (NM_001243211): The protein encoded by this gene is a proinflammatory cytokine that augments natural killer cell activity in spleen cells, and stimulates interferon gamma production in T-helper type I cells. Alternatively spliced transcript variants encoding different isoforms have been found for this gene.[provided by RefSeq, Aug 2011]. allergic rhinitis Kruse S 2003, Polymorphisms in the IL 18 gene are associated with specific sensitization to common allergens and allergic rhinitis., The Journal of allergy and clinical immunology. 2003 Jan;111(1):117-22.
[PubMed 12532106]
IL18 might be responsible for the linkage effects seen in the chromosomal region 11q22, which has been found previously with the phenotype sensitization to mite allergen. Thus a suspected direct role of IL18 in the pathogenesis of atopy has been strengthened by the presence of 8 common SNPs in the promoter regions of IL18.
Alzheimer's disease Bossu, P. et al. 2007, Interleukin-18 gene polymorphisms predict risk and outcome of Alzheimer's disease, J Neurol Neurosurg Psychiatry 2007.
[PubMed 17299019]
As IL-18 cytokine promoter gene polymorphisms have been previously described to have functional consequences on IL-18 expression, it is possible that individuals with a prevalent IL-18 gene variant have a dysregulated immune response, suggesting that IL-18 mediated immune mechanisms may play a crucial role in AD.
anti-GAD65 antibody Hiromatsu, Y. et al. 2006, IL-18 gene polymorphism confers susceptibility to the development of anti-GAD65 antibody in Graves' disease, Diabet Med 2006 23(2) 211-5.
[PubMed 16433722]
These findings in a Japanese population indicate that Graves disease patients carrying the GG genotype at position -4657 of the promoter of the IL-18 gene or a gene in linkage disequilibrium with the -4675G/-607A/-137G haplotype have a low risk for the development of GAD65Ab in Graves disease.
The RNAfold program from the Vienna RNA Package is used to perform the secondary structure predictions and folding calculations. The estimated folding energy is in kcal/mol. The more negative the energy, the more secondary structure the RNA is likely to have.

Orthologous Genes in Other Species
Orthologies between human, mouse, and rat are computed by taking the best BLASTP hit, and filtering out non-syntenic hits. For more distant species reciprocal-best BLASTP hits are used. Note that the absence of an ortholog in the table below may reflect incomplete annotations in the other species rather than a true absence of the orthologous gene.
